DCCA rallies, repeat as women’s champ
Nadia Tagabuel blasted a three-run, inside-the-park home run in Game 2 to help Department of Community and Cultural Affairs repeat as the women’s division champion in the Inter-government Softball League.
DCCA used an eight-run bottom of the sixth scoring spree to score a come-from-behind 13-10 win over the Northern Marianas College-Proa in Friday night’s finals at the Miguel Basa “Tan Ge” Pangelinan Field.
Trailing 10-5, after 5 1/2 innings, Arlene Likisap led off with a single off relief pitcher Angela Ngirbedul. She advanced to second on a Benny Mettao fielder’s choice then moved to third on another fielder’s choice by Ruth Sakisat with Likisap scoring in that play.
Mettao, however, was tagged out on a 6-4-put-out play while trying to reach second base for the first out. Abby Atalig singled in Sakisat while Lorna Iginoef walked to continue DCCA’s comeback.
But Iginoef was tagged out while going to second bas on an Evita Maratita fielder’s choice as Proa kept DCCA’s runners on hold at first base. Bert Camacho, with two outs, singled while Doris Rangamar walked.
Jovie Omar then connected on a two-RBI single to let Maratita and Camacho reach home while Rangamar moved to third in the same play.
That set up Tagabuel’s three-run shot as she brought Ngirbedul’s 2-2 pitch, still with two outs, sailing deep at the right-center field fence.
Nadia Saralu grounded out on a 4-3 put-out play to end the inning.
Proa still has a chance to force a Game 3 but Omar slammed the door shut in the top of the seventh by forcing them to either fly out or ground out, which was fielded cleanly by the DCCA defense.
Likisap and Atalig combined for 6-for-6 in batting with two runs and two RBIs, while Bert Camacho went 3-for-4 with three runs and Rangamar went 2-for-4 with two RBIs and two runs scored.
Omar went 2-for-4 scoring two runs, had three RBIs, and a triple while Tagabuel, who was named the finals most valuable player, went 2-for-4 with four RBIs to go with her two runs and a bottom of the sixth four-bagger.
The members of the DCCA team are Evita Maratita, Bert Camacho, Doris Rangamar, Jovie Omar, Nadia Tagabuel, Nadia Saralu, Arlene Likisap, Benny Mettao, Ruth Sakisat, Abby Atalig, and Lorna Iginoef.
DCCA won Game 1 earlier in the day, 18-14, to complete the shutout win and their title defense.
